Bonilla Luis Miguel Palomino Sells 100 Shares of Southern Copper (NYSE:SCCO) Stock

Southern Copper Corporation (NYSE:SCCOGet Free Report) Director Luis Palomino Bonilla sold 100 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ction dated Tuesday, September 8th. The stock was sold at an average price of $210.00, for a total value of $21,000.00. Following the completion of the sale, the director owned 1,503 shares in the company, valued at $315,630. This represents a 6.24%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through the SEC website.

Southern Copper (NYSE:SCCOG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 22nd. The basic materials company reported $1.99 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.93 by $0.06. Southern Copper had a net margin of 35.87% and a return on equity of 49.04%. The company had revenue of $4.29 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$4.37 billion. The business’s revenue was up 40.6% on a year-over-year basis. Sell-side analysts anticipate that Southern Copper Corporation will post 7.83 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Southern Copper Increases Dividend

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, August 27th. Investors of record on Tuesday, August 11th were issued a $1.10 dividend. This represents a $4.40 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.3%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Tuesday, August 11th. This is a positive change from Southern Copper’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.00. Southern Copper’s payout ratio is 64.33%.

About Southern Copper

Southern Copper Corporation (NYSE: SCCO) is an integrated copper producer engaged in the exploration, mining, processing, smelting and refining of minerals. The company produces copper in the form of cathodes, concentrates and anodes, along with byproducts including molybdenum, zinc, silver, lead and sulfuric acid.

Southern Copper operates mining and processing facilities in Mexico and Peru. Its principal Mexican operations include the Buenavista del Cobre and La Caridad mining complexes, while its Peruvian operations include the Toquepala and Cuajone mines and the Ilo smelter and refinery.
